Motorcycle passenger killed in Marcellus crash, State Police say
Summary
Motorcycle Crash Marcellus New York in Marcellus, New York: On June 21 at about 10:10 a.m., an 18‑year‑old driver from Chaumont operating a 2024 Subaru northbound on Slate Hill Road failed to yield the right-of-way when entering the intersection with U.S. Route 20 and collided with a 2014 Harley‑Davidson motorcycle traveling eastbound. The motorcycle’s 55‑year‑old operator and his 55‑year‑old female passenger were ejected; both were taken to Upstate University Hospital, where the passenger was later pronounced dead while the operator remained hospitalized with non‑life‑threatening injuries. State Police said the Subaru driver was uninjured, and a preliminary investigation is ongoing with assistance from local law enforcement and fire departments.
